We have published a -07 version of lightweight 4over6. This new version 
improves the preciseness of the ICMP handling mechanism description.

Up to now, this draft has finished merging with I-D.zhou-softwire-b4-nat and 
I-D.penno-softwire-sdnat as requested by the WG and has settled all the 
technical details based on comments from the WG. It reflects widely 
requirements from 7 operators including China Telecom, Tsinghua, Comcast, 
France Telecom, Deutsche Telekom,Bouygues Telecom and Freebits, and vendors 
from Huawei, Juniper and Cisco. It has running code already published in 
http://sourceforge.net/projects/laft6/ and has a field trial in commerial 
network.

Abstract:
   This document specifies an extension to DS-Lite called Lightweight
   4over6.  This mechanism moves the translation function from the
   tunnel concentrator (AFTR) to initiators (B4s), and hence reduces the
   mapping scale on the concentrator to a per-subscriber level.  To
   delegate the NAPT function to the initiators, port-restricted IPv4
   addresses are allocated to the initiators.
